Jimtown Junior High School

Jimtown Junior High School is a public middle school in Elkhart, IN, serving grades 7–8, rated B-, with 305 students and a 19.3:1 student-teacher ratio.

In 2024-2025, the share of students meeting the state standard was 47% in English Language Arts.

About Jimtown Junior High School

How is Jimtown Junior High School rated?

Jimtown Junior High School holds a B- rating on TopHap's A-to-D scale, which blends state test results, academic progress and student outcomes. Baugo Community Schools is rated B overall.

How do students at Jimtown Junior High School perform on state tests?

In the 2024-2025 testing year, the share of Jimtown Junior High School students meeting or exceeding the state standard was 47% in English Language Arts.

What grades does Jimtown Junior High School serve?

Jimtown Junior High School serves grades 7–8 as a middle school.

How many students attend Jimtown Junior High School?

305 students attend Jimtown Junior High School, up from 287 the prior year, with a student-teacher ratio of 19.3:1.

Which school district is Jimtown Junior High School in?

Jimtown Junior High School is part of Baugo Community Schools, which reports 4 schools, 1,849 students and $10,734 of spending per student.
